To understand the current romantic landscape, one must first look back at its origins. The first-ever Pashto-language film, Yousuf Khan Sher Bano , was released in December 1970. Directed by Aziz Tabassum, this cinematic landmark was based on a classic Pashto folk story often referred to as the Pashto version of Romeo and Juliet . It became an instant cultural phenomenon, running for 50 weeks at number one in Peshawar. This film ignited a cinematic revolution, and audiences flocked to theaters to see stories told in their own language, rooted in their own traditions.
